EA Goes Private: Staff Voice Unease Over New Ownership and Future

Electronic Arts has recently transitioned to private ownership following a significant acquisition backed by the Saudi Arabian government and Jared Kushner. With the finalization of this deal, EA employees are now contemplating the potential ramifications this change in stewardship could have on their roles and the company’s direction moving forward.

Among the staff, there is considerable apprehension regarding job security, with fears of widespread layoffs and the possibility that certain development teams or established game franchises might be divested. Adding to this uncertainty, some employees have reportedly suggested that the company’s internal culture lacked the ethical foundation to resist an acquisition of this nature, reflecting a deeper unease about the corporate values at play.

As the dust settles on this major corporate shift, the overall sentiment within EA appears to be one of concern and uncertainty regarding what the future holds under its new private status and ownership. This report is based on findings by Rock Paper Shotgun.
